Jay brings up a good point: rechargeable batteries are a must, unless
you want to spend lots of money on batteries. Standard or non-standard,
rechargeable.
I have a Nikon Coolpix 995, which I like very much. It uses a
non-standard battery which is fairly expensive from Nikon, but the
camera has been out long enough (not too long these days) for
aftermarket batteries to show up, cheaper and with more capacity.
One problem with my camera is that it doesn't do well in low light. A
camera with a focusing light seems like a good idea to me.

Jay Hayes wrote:
> Both my daughter and her roommate at college each have a Fuji Finepix
> 1650. The LCD view finder on both cameras went bad. I sent my daughter's
> camera back to Fuji USA four weeks ago and they still haven't fixed it.
> When I call customer service I usually have a twenty minute wait on hold
> before I get to talk with anyone. Her roommate had her camera repaired
> by an independent camera repair shop and had it back in two days.
>
> I would never buy a Fuji camera again.
>
> I just bought a Casio QV-R40 for $287 at Sams. It is a 4 mega pixel
> camera and smaller than a pack of cigarettes . It takes a great picture
> and best of all uses two AA rechargeable or standard batteries. The
> special batteries used in a lot of the new digital cameras can run $40
> -$50 each.
